Jonglei Governor sends Bor County out of capital

By Philip Thon Aleu

February 18, 2009 (BOR TOWN) — Lt. Gen., Jonglei Governor Kuol Manyang Juuk has ordered Bor County headquarters (HQs) to quit Bor Town for Werkok, about 12 miles east Bor Town, with immediate effect. Bor commissioner says he will comply since “it is an order.”

Kuol told reporters here on Monday that the decision aims at reducing insecurity in deserted Bor villages and utilization of facilities left behind as the population seek refuge at better secured areas around Jonglei capital. The oral order has been repeatedly rejected by Bor Community leaders.

“The policy of the Government of Southern Sudan is taking towns to the people which has made it a necessity [for Bor County] to transfer [the HQs] to Werkok. This will encouraged the population in Bor Town to go back to use the abandoned permanently built schools, hospitals and clean water point,” Gov. Kuol Manyang said.

When asked about the safety of the administrative units in Werkok given rampant raiding by Murle tribesmen there, Gov. Kuol Manyang says: “If our people are in the Countryside, what is wrong with the administration.” Manyang, however, advised Bor community to stop scattered settlement. Gov. Kuol pledged that security situation in Jonglei State will improve within the next two months without elaborating.

Bor County commissioner Abraham Jok Ariing told the Sudan Tribune later on Monday that he will respect his community decision of not negotiating with Gov. Kuol Manyang since it is an order.

Bor community leaders rejected their County’s HQs relocation to Werkok twice (in 2006 and recently in December, 2008) on ground that it is very close to Bor Town to meet the said aims. Dividing Bor County into two and budget insufficiency are yet other reasons cited by Bor leaders to consider moving out of the long inhibited HQs since colonial period.

Ariing however observed moving to Werkok is not a complete success unless the government does more.

“We have to convince the community through services and therefore we need a lot to be done to meet the aim,” he said referring to relocation to Werkok at the interest of attracting Bor community back to their villages. “Going to Werkok will not make security 100% perfect,” he said adding “our departure from here is not at the interest of the community but if the government thinks it s good, then we shall go.”

Ariing also seek compensations of buildings to be left behind in Bor town and increasing the 900 police composed of mainly elder persons and child bearing-age women.

Southern Sudan campaign of “Taking town to the people” has a lot of economically backed resistance from Counties hosting capitals including the seat of GoSS at Juba.

The host Counties benefits from revenue collection and employment opportunities making relocation to distance centers unthinkable, but Bor Commissioner Jok Ariing says his County will continue taking 60% local taxes collection.

But Bor County’s youths are divided over the issue with others claiming better prosperity at home.

“If our headquarters is taken to Werkok, our people will feel close to the government and comfortably remain at their ancestors’ house,” Daniel Kou, a student at John Garang Institute told the Sudan Tribune here on Monday.

“The government of Jonglei State should respect community views and stop forcing people out of Bor Town,” a man identified as Simon said.
